NPO Energomash has assembled the second liquid rocket engine RD-171MV, which is considered the most powerful in the world. It can put up to 17 tons of cargo into a reference orbit. This flight model is used in the first stage of the Soyuz-5 medium-class launch vehicle.
RD171MV is a modernized version of the RD-171M engine, it was developed and assembled in 6 years. This is the first engine that the designers of the Roscosmos "daughter" company designed as an electronic 3D model.
After the assembly of the third sample, scientists will begin interdepartmental tests of the RD-171MV and its serial production for the completion of Soyuz-5.
